Marion County approves $176,810 DOJ reimbursement grant for jail costs
Summary
The Marion County Board of Commissioners approved a Department of Justice Bureau of Justice Assistance award of $176,810 under the State Criminal Alien Assistance Program to reimburse jail costs; county legal counsel reviewed the award and commissioners said the funds free up general fund dollars.
The Marion County Board of Commissioners voted to accept incoming funds from the U.S. Department of Justice Bureau of Justice Assistance, approving a State Criminal Alien Assistance Program (SCAAP) award of $176,810 for reimbursements related to housing people in the county jail. The motion passed unanimously during the board's regular session.
